Can AI Enhance RAG Evaluation?

Imagine if RAG evaluation could not only detect problems but predict them before they occur. Intrigued? This is no longer a science fiction dream but a realistic application of AI technology in the realm of quality assurance. Let’s dive into how AI is revolutionizing RAG evaluation and potentially redefining your quality testing processes.

The Role of AI in Quality Assurance

AI’s primary strength lies in its ability to analyze large datasets rapidly and extract actionable insights. In quality assurance, this capability translates into identifying discrepancies that might escape human testers, leading to enhanced error detection and improved product reliability.

Improving RAG Evaluation Efficiency

Traditional RAG (Red-Amber-Green) evaluation relies on manual checks against predefined criteria, which can be both time-consuming and error-prone. Enter AI algorithms, which can automate these checks with enhanced precision and swiftness. By harnessing machine learning models, we can train AI systems to adaptively learn from past data, recognizing patterns that signal potential issues before they materialize.

Want to explore more about predictive capabilities? Check out Can Machine Learning Predict Bugs Before They Happen? for deeper insights.

AI-Enhanced RAG vs. Standard RAG: A Comparative Analysis

When pitted against standard RAG evaluation, AI-enhanced systems offer a significant leap in efficiency. While traditional methods might take hours to identify and address issues, AI can perform the same tasks in a fraction of the time. Moreover, AI provides a level of consistency that human-driven processes often lack, reducing variability in quality evaluations.

For those interested in exploring the practical implications of RAG evaluation further, don’t miss Debunking Myths: What RAG Evaluation Can Really Do for Your QA Process.

Examples from the Real World

Consider a scenario at a mid-sized company where AI-driven RAG evaluation was integrated into their CI/CD pipeline. Prior to AI adoption, their release cycles were frequently delayed due to last-minute issue detection. With AI, not only did issue detection become quicker, but the level of detail provided allowed for faster resolution, ultimately leading to more predictable and reliable release cycles.

Best Practices for Implementing AI in RAG Systems

Successful AI integration requires more than just adopting new technology; it involves cultural shifts and strategic planning. Here are some practices to consider:

  • Ensure your data sets are diverse and comprehensive to train robust AI models.
  • Facilitate cross-functional collaboration to bridge any gaps between AI teams and traditional QA teams.
  • Monitor AI predictions continuously to tweak and train models for improved accuracy.

Future Outlook: AI and the Evolution of Automated Testing

As AI continues to embed itself in quality assurance processes, its role is likely to grow from supportive to indispensable. The vision for the future involves AI systems capable of autonomously prioritizing test scenarios based on predicted impact and risk, thus streamlining the entire QA process.

Thinking about the next steps towards automation? Learn more about the integration of AI into existing systems by reading Bridging the Gap: How AI Enhances Scriptless Testing Efficiency.

The journey to leveraging AI in RAG evaluation is one of progress and innovation, offering a competitive edge for those willing to embrace it. So, the question isn’t whether AI can enhance RAG evaluation—it’s how soon can you start implementing it in your processes?